Transaction 51d2e46590d6afbb4e79a6bb818626560c8caf493737cd5c30607aaff136780d
1 Input
1 Output
-
51d2e46590d6afbb4e79a6bb818626560c8caf493737cd5c30607aaff136780d:0
- value
- 11020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 990dcdef916784f7d5b492e31c64cb6b9fa97104 OP_EQUAL
- address
- 3FeHr3SXwLfFhF4a4UqQT5DACDvdBbmDLY